    I own a reefer but I've only rarely hauled fresh produce of any kind for this very reason. I have a logging system, but I decided a long time ago that I didn't want to deal with the headaches of hauling produce. There are too many high paying loads of pre-packaged "chilled" food products that aren't frozen to bother with fresh produce. Even ice cream is barely worth the trouble, especially in summer with high temps outside.

    May have been said already but go to a carrier or thermo king dealer and get a data download. Simple.
